PARAMOUNT RESIDENTIAL MORTGAGE GROUP, INC. closing costs and rates (2024)
In 2024, PARAMOUNT RESIDENTIAL MORTGAGE GROUP, INC. originated 15,370 purchase mortgages at a median interest rate of 6.62% and median total closing costs of $11,248. That ranks #27 nationally by origination volume. For total closing costs among lenders with 500+ originations, PARAMOUNT RESIDENTIAL MORTGAGE GROUP, INC. ranks #583. That is $4,507 above the national median of $6,741. PARAMOUNT RESIDENTIAL MORTGAGE GROUP, INC. is most active in Florida with 3,229 originations there.

Breakdown by loan type
| Loan type | Volume | Median Rate | Median Total Costs | Median Origination |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| conventional | 7,024 | 6.875% | $8,657 | $4,814 |
| fha | 6,591 | 6.500% | $14,666 | $4,683 |
| va | 1,388 | 6.250% | $9,352 | $2,082 |
| usda | 367 | 6.625% | $6,639 | $1,860 |

Data source: HMDA Modified Loan Application Register 2024, published by the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B).
Statistics reflect originated first-lien purchase mortgages on owner-occupied principal residences. Medians exclude loans with exempt or unreported fee disclosures. Learn more at ffiec.cfpb.gov.
